naden: Css Div Container Bug?

Hi,
ich habe habe folgendes Problem.

ich habe einen DIV Container, der absolut positioniert ist.
In diesem liegt ein weiterer unsichbarer Container, der
vergleichbar mit einem Tooltip bei onmouseover sichtbar wird.
Allerdings gibt es Probleme mit der Positionierung, da der
innere Container seinen umgebenden stets als Bezug nimmt.
Ich suche eine Möglichkeit, den inneren Container an den
Koordinaten 0/0 des Browsers anzuzeigen.

Ich habe ein kleines Beispiel hier online gestellt. Es wäre
schön, wenn jemand dort mal reinsieht.
Das Beispiel ist extrem abgespeckt, um nur dieses eine Problem
zu veranschaulichen und hat keinen Anspruch darauf unter jeder
OS/Browser-Konfiguration zu funktionieren.

http://www.naden.de/public/tests/css-div-container-bug.php

Gruß Naden

  1. habe d'ehre

    Allerdings gibt es Probleme mit der Positionierung, da der
    innere Container seinen umgebenden stets als Bezug nimmt.
    Ich suche eine Möglichkeit, den inneren Container an den
    Koordinaten 0/0 des Browsers anzuzeigen.

    Nimm #popup aus #main raus.

    <div id="main">
    </div>

    <div id="popup">
    </div>

    man liest sich
    Wilhelm

    1. »

      Nimm #popup aus #main raus.

      <div id="main">
      </div>

      <div id="popup">
      </div>

      Der Code wird remote eingebunden auf anderen Seiten, insofern habe ich absolut keine Kontrolle darüber, wie der umgebende Code aussieht.

      Ich versuche nun über "appendChild" einen DIV container im <body> zu einzubinden mal sehen ob es darüber eine Lösung gibt.

  2. Hi,

    ich habe einen DIV Container, der absolut positioniert ist.
    In diesem liegt ein weiterer unsichbarer Container, der
    vergleichbar mit einem Tooltip bei onmouseover sichtbar wird.
    Allerdings gibt es Probleme mit der Positionierung, da der
    innere Container seinen umgebenden stets als Bezug nimmt.

    Das ist vollkommen korrekt so.

    Ich suche eine Möglichkeit, den inneren Container an den
    Koordinaten 0/0 des Browsers anzuzeigen.

    Hm. Du kennst doch die Position des äußeren Containers.
    Ziehe also einfach dessen left/top Wert vom gewünschten left/top Wert für den inneren Container ab.

    cu,
    Andreas

    --
    Warum nennt sich Andreas hier MudGuard?
    Schreinerei Waechter
    Fachfragen per E-Mail halte ich für unverschämt und werde entsprechende E-Mails nicht beantworten. Für Fachfragen ist das Forum da.
    1. Hm. Du kennst doch die Position des äußeren Containers.
      Ziehe also einfach dessen left/top Wert vom gewünschten left/top Wert für den inneren Container ab.

      Der Code wird remote eingebunden auf anderen Seiten, insofern habe ich absolut keine Kontrolle darüber, wie der umgebende Code aussieht.

      cu,
      Andreas